Output 18fd8b120c30f8e7e79e33c50816a63da67517e81a6aec24c0a56f69ec9539d5:1

value
148970
script pubkey
OP_0 OP_PUSHBYTES_20 3e6e3b86fe48fed9f22c49e0b0052a5bf128e931
address
ltc1q8ehrhph7frldnu3vf8stqpf2t0cj36f37ws8e9
transaction
18fd8b120c30f8e7e79e33c50816a63da67517e81a6aec24c0a56f69ec9539d5
spent
true